WebThe Mental Health Act. The Mental Health Act (the Act) is the main piece of legislation guiding the compulsory inpatient admission and treatment of people with mental health problems in England and Wales. WebNov 30, 2024 · The project management triangle is made up of three variables that determine the quality of the project: scope, cost, and time. The triangle demonstrates how these three variables are linked—if one of the variables is changed, the other two must be adjusted in order to keep the triangle connected. WebThe area of the rectangle is bh=4\times 5 = 20 bh = 4 ×5 = 20 square units, so the area of the triangle is \dfrac 12 bh = \dfrac 12 \times 4 \times 5 = 10 21bh = 21 ×4×5 = 10 square units. Key intuition: A triangle is half as big as the rectangle that surrounds it, which is why the area of a triangle is one-half base times height. WebAnthrax is an acute infectious disease that usually occurs in animals such as livestock, but can also affect humans. Human anthrax comes in three forms, depending on the route of infection: cutaneous (skin) anthrax, inhalation anthrax, and intestinal anthrax. Symptoms usually occur within 7 days after exposure.

WebThe Triangle of Care guide was launched in July 2010 by The Princess Royal Trust for Carers (now Carers Trust) and the National Mental Health Development Unit to highlight the need for better involvement of carers and families in the care planning and treatment of people with mental ill-health.
